    What is Cost Inflation Index (CII) for FY 2024-25, FY 2023-24 for income tax purposes?

    CII number for FY 2023-24, FY 2024-25: The income tax department notifies cost inflation index number for every financial year. This CII number helps to calculate inflation adjusted cost or inflation indexed cost on specified capital costs. Read on to know the CII number from 2001-02 for different financial years.

    NBFC Akme Fintrade's IPO to open on June 19, announces price band

    Udaipur-based non-bank financial company Akme Fintrade (India)'s IPO will open for subscription on June 19 and close on June 21. The issue is completely a fresh equity sale of Rs 1.10 crore shares of face value Rs 10 each.

    GAIL, PNB, IREDA among PSU stocks that mutual funds exited before election results

    ​Mutual funds sold shares in several PSU stocks in May ahead of the June 4 outcome with GAIL (India), Punjab National Bank (PNB), Power Finance Corporation (PFC), NHPC and Indian Renewable Energy Development Agency (IREDA) witnessing complete exit by individual mutual funds.
